Anyone with H&R springs installed?

Ok, I just took delivery of my 09 C63 with full PP (except Carbon) and I am putting wheels on it soon and would like to ditch the wheel gap while improving handling. I have in the past almost always gone with full coilovers for all the obvious advantages. However, with the PP it doesn't really make sense but what I don't want is the bounce that you sometimes get in shorter springs.

Any thoughts?
